Dear all,

After I installed the latest version and compile the example of HelloWorld, the following problem occured. Does anyone know what is happening? Thanks a lot!


----- CtrlLib ( GUI MSC8 DEBUG DEBUG_FULL BLITZ WIN32 MSC ) (1 / 9)
BLITZ: LabelBase.cpp Button.cpp Switch.cpp EditField.cpp Text.cpp LineEdit.cpp DocEdit.cpp ScrollBar.cpp Head
erCtrl.cpp ArrayCtrl.cpp DropList.cpp DropPusher.cpp DropChoice.cpp Static.cpp Splitter.cpp SliderCtrl.cp
p ColumnList.cpp Progress.cpp AKeys.cpp RichTextView.cpp RichClip.cpp Prompt.cpp Help.cpp Bar.cpp MenuBar
.cpp ToolBar.cpp ToolTip.cpp StatusBar.cpp TabCtrl.cpp TreeCtrl.cpp DlgColor.cpp ColorPopup.cpp ColorPush
er.cpp FileList.cpp FileSel.cpp Windows.cpp Win32.cpp CtrlUtil.cpp Update.cpp LNGCtrl.cpp
$blitz.cpp
C:\upp\uppsrc\Core/Core.h(225) : fatal error C1083: Cannot open include file: 'windef.h': No such file or dir
ectory
CtrlLib.icpp
C:\upp\uppsrc\Core/Core.h(225) : fatal error C1083: Cannot open include file: 'windef.h': No such file or dir
ectory

1 file(s) compiled in (0:00.69) 691 msec/file

There were errors. (0:01.59)

Just a note: The SDK is NOT installed with VC++ Express, I have a copy of 2005 and I had to download the Windows Server SDK before anything would compile.
